BBC reportedly producing Killing Eve prequel Honey

The BBC is reportedly developing a prequel to the popular series Killing Eve, titled Honey. Described as a Cold War thriller, the project focuses on MI6 boss Carolyn Martens from the original show.

Reports indicate that the BBC is working on a prequel to Killing Eve, the acclaimed spy thriller series. The new project, named Honey, has been characterized as a Cold War thriller. However, sources close to the production reveal that it centers on Carolyn Martens, the MI6 boss portrayed by Fiona Shaw in the original series.

This development comes as an expansion of the Killing Eve universe, which originally aired from 2018 to 2022 and followed the cat-and-mouse dynamic between an MI6 agent and a psychopathic assassin. Details about Honey remain limited, with the emphasis on its shadowy origins tied to Martens' backstory. No official confirmation has been issued by the BBC or the show's creators, leaving the project's status as reported rather than finalized.

The prequel aims to delve into the Cold War era, potentially exploring the formative years of key intelligence figures like Martens. Fans of the series, known for its sharp writing and tense espionage plots, may anticipate how this ties into the established narrative.

HBO developing 'V for Vendetta' TV series adaptation

Imeripotiwa na AI Picha iliyoundwa na AI

HBO is in development on a new TV series based on the iconic DC Comics graphic novel 'V for Vendetta,' with Pete Jackson attached to write and James Gunn and Peter Safran executive producing for DC Studios. The project, produced by Warner Bros. Television, adapts the dystopian story of anarchist V and Evey Hammond in a fascist Britain. This marks another live-action DC property for HBO, following successes like 'The Penguin' and the upcoming 'Lanterns.'

A decade after its debut, 'The Night Manager' returns for a second season on BBC and Amazon Prime, with Tom Hiddleston reprising his role as spy Jonathan Pine. Director Georgi Banks-Davies discusses adapting the John le Carré thriller for a post-truth era and expanding beyond the original novels with the author's blessing. The six-part series explores themes of identity and national allegiance in a post-Brexit world.

Idris Elba will reprise his role as detective John Luther in a new Netflix movie, the second feature adaptation following 2023's Luther: The Fallen Sun. The film reunites Elba with Ruth Wilson as Alice Morgan and Dermot Crowley as Martin Schenk, directed by Jamie Payne from a script by series creator Neil Cross. Production is set to begin filming in February 2026.

The BBC's hit reality show The Traitors returns with its fourth civilian season, featuring a groundbreaking twist that introduces a secret traitor among the faithfuls. This change aims to heighten deception and strategy, promising more intense gameplay following the success of the recent celebrity edition. Hosted by Claudia Winkleman, the series begins with 22 contestants arriving at the castle for a month-long psychological game.
